برنامج التحكم في الميكروكنترولر عبر المنفذ المتوالي serial port

السلام عليكم و رحمة الله تعالى وبركاته

-نبذة عن البرنامج

اضع بين ايديكم برنامج التحكم في 13 مخرج من مخارج أي نوع من أنواع الميكروكنترولر التي تحتوي على وحدة UART أي تقريبا جميع الانواع PIC,AVR,ATMEL,8051…..

-طريق اشتغال البرنامج

البرنامج يعتمد على ارسال الحروف من A الى M  عبر منفذ التوالي

فإذا اردنا تفعيل احد اقطاب الميكروكنترولر نرسل حرف كبير أي uppercase   على سبيل المثال A لتفعيل المخرج الاول

و لاطفائه نرسل نفس الحرف و لكن حرف صغير lowercase أي a

من بعد يقوم البرنامج باستفسار الميكروكنترولر عن حالة كل قطب هل مفعل أو منطفأ

ثم يجيب الميكروكنترولر عبر ارسال 13 حرف كل حرف حسب حالة القطب يرسل حرف كبير اذا كان خرج القطب 5 فولت او حرف صغير اذا كان خرج القطب 0 فولت.

-تحميل البرنامج

 http://www.techporte.com/wp-content/uploads/2016/09/UART.zip

 

scheme_rs232

1

 – كود الميكروسي استعملت هنا ميكرو من نوع PIC16f628A

 

اضف رد

لن يتم نشر البريد الإلكتروني . الحقول المطلوبة مشار لها بـ *

*

يمكنك استخدام أكواد HTML والخصائص التالية: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code class="" title="" data-url="">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<pre class="" title="" data-url=""> <span class="" title="" data-url="">